What Is Wood Rot Repair?

Wood rot is one of the most common and damaging issues in Texas homes due to humidity,

rain, and inconsistent weather. If not addressed quickly, wood rot can spread and affect

structural framing, windows, doors, fascia, trim, and siding—leading to costly repairs.

We offer expert wood rot repair in Dallas, identifying the moisture source, removing all

compromised areas, and replacing them with high-quality, durable materials. After repairs, we

prep, prime, and paint the restored surfaces to ensure long-term protection.

Common areas we repair include:

● Window trim

● Fascia boards

● Soffits

● Exterior doors

● Deck boards

● Columns and posts

● Siding panels

By repairing wood rot before painting, you ensure the new paint adheres properly and lasts

longer—preserving both the appearance and integrity of your home.

Why Is Wood Rot Repair Important?

Wood Rot Repair & Replacement is crucial for maintaining the safety, value, and appearance of a property. Rotten wood can compromise the structural integrity of a building, leading to potential safety hazards and costly repairs if left unaddressed. Moreover, wood rot can spread, affecting larger areas and necessitating more extensive repairs over time. By addressing wood rot early, homeowners can prevent further damage, preserve the property's value, and avoid the health risks associated with mold and mildew, which often accompany rotting wood. This service is essential for ensuring a healthy, safe, and structurally sound living environment.

When Should You Consider Wood Rot Repair?

Consider Wood Rot Repair & Replacement when you notice signs of decay or damage to wooden elements of your property. Early indicators include discolored patches on wood, a musty smell, soft or spongy texture upon touch, or visible growths of fungus. Additionally, if your property has experienced water damage or has areas prone to moisture accumulation, it is prudent to inspect for wood rot as a preventive measure. Acting promptly upon these signs can save significant time and expense by addressing the issue before it worsens. Regular maintenance checks, especially in older homes or those in damp climates, can help in identifying potential problems early.
